svnwindows(SVNwindows版本)
# 简介SVN(Subversion)是一种广泛使用的版本控制系统,它帮助团队协作开发软件项目时有效地管理代码变更、追踪历史记录以及解决冲突。而SVN for Windows(简称SVNWindows)是针对Windows操作系统优化的SVN客户端工具,它允许开发者在Windows环境下轻松地进行版本控制操作。本文将详细介绍SVNWindows的功能特点、安装配置方法及其实际应用。# 多级标题1. SVNWindows概述
2. 安装与配置
3. 基本操作指南
4. 高级功能解析
5. 常见问题解答 ---# 内容详细说明## 1. SVNWindows概述SVNWindows是一个专为Windows用户设计的SVN客户端工具,它不仅支持传统的命令行操作,还提供了图形化界面,使得版本控制变得更加直观和便捷。通过SVNWindows,开发者可以高效地完成文件的检出、提交、更新等常见任务,并且能够实时监控项目的变更情况。此外,SVNWindows兼容多种版本的Windows系统,从早期的XP到最新的Windows 10/11都可以正常运行。同时,该工具对中文环境有良好的支持,非常适合国内开发者使用。## 2. 安装与配置### 下载安装包
首先访问官方或可信的第三方网站下载最新版本的SVNWindows安装程序。通常情况下,安装包会以`.exe`格式提供。### 执行安装
双击下载好的安装文件后,按照提示一步步完成安装过程。在安装过程中需要注意选择合适的安装路径,并确保勾选了所有必要的组件。### 配置环境变量
为了方便使用命令行工具,建议将SVN安装目录添加到系统的PATH环境变量中。这样可以在任何位置直接运行`svn`命令。## 3. 基本操作指南### 初始化仓库
在开始工作之前,需要先创建一个版本库。可以通过以下步骤来实现:
- 打开命令提示符。
- 输入`svnadmin create
简介SVN(Subversion)是一种广泛使用的版本控制系统,它帮助团队协作开发软件项目时有效地管理代码变更、追踪历史记录以及解决冲突。而SVN for Windows(简称SVNWindows)是针对Windows操作系统优化的SVN客户端工具,它允许开发者在Windows环境下轻松地进行版本控制操作。本文将详细介绍SVNWindows的功能特点、安装配置方法及其实际应用。
多级标题1. SVNWindows概述 2. 安装与配置 3. 基本操作指南 4. 高级功能解析 5. 常见问题解答 ---
内容详细说明
1. SVNWindows概述SVNWindows是一个专为Windows用户设计的SVN客户端工具,它不仅支持传统的命令行操作,还提供了图形化界面,使得版本控制变得更加直观和便捷。通过SVNWindows,开发者可以高效地完成文件的检出、提交、更新等常见任务,并且能够实时监控项目的变更情况。此外,SVNWindows兼容多种版本的Windows系统,从早期的XP到最新的Windows 10/11都可以正常运行。同时,该工具对中文环境有良好的支持,非常适合国内开发者使用。
2. 安装与配置
下载安装包 首先访问官方或可信的第三方网站下载最新版本的SVNWindows安装程序。通常情况下,安装包会以`.exe`格式提供。
执行安装 双击下载好的安装文件后,按照提示一步步完成安装过程。在安装过程中需要注意选择合适的安装路径,并确保勾选了所有必要的组件。
配置环境变量 为了方便使用命令行工具,建议将SVN安装目录添加到系统的PATH环境变量中。这样可以在任何位置直接运行`svn`命令。
3. 基本操作指南
初始化仓库
在开始工作之前,需要先创建一个版本库。可以通过以下步骤来实现:
- 打开命令提示符。
- 输入`svnadmin create
检出代码 检出是指从远程仓库获取代码到本地的过程。执行如下命令即可: ```bash svn checkout http://your-repository-url ```
提交更改 当你修改了某些文件并准备保存这些更改时,可以使用以下命令: ```bash svn commit -m "Your commit message" ```
4. 高级功能解析除了基础功能外,SVNWindows还提供了许多高级特性,例如分支管理、标签创建以及合并策略设置等。这些功能对于复杂项目的开发至关重要。例如,在处理分支时,可以利用`svn copy`命令快速复制当前分支或者主干,并将其标记为一个新的分支点。
5. 常见问题解答
Q: 如何解决冲突? A: 当多人同时修改同一文件时可能会发生冲突。此时,SVN会提示你手动解决冲突,完成后记得再次提交。
Q: 是否支持中文字符? A: 是的,SVNWindows对中文字符有着很好的支持,无论是文件名还是注释都可以正常使用中文。---通过以上介绍可以看出,SVNWindows是一款强大且易于使用的版本控制工具,尤其适合Windows平台下的团队协作开发。希望本文能帮助大家更好地理解和使用这一工具!